The Department of Chemistry and Biochemistry
Degree Requirements
The Bachelor of Science in Chemistry is intended for students who plan a career in chemistry. The B.S. is accredited by the American Chemical Society. Students who satisfactorily complete this program are recommended by the department for certification as graduate chemists by the American Chemical Society. The B.S. prepares students to enter the job market or for graduate study leading to an advanced degree, such as a Master of Science or Doctor of Philosophy.
Note: Chemistry majors may not take courses listed in the major or additional requirements for CR/NC grades.
